Besides the display, you will need the ADAHRS, pitot tube, and backup battery. That will give you basic flying data. Adding the engine module will give you the engine instruments you need. Everything else is determined by your desires and pocketbook.
 
The SkyView uses a network system using serial data.
The probes on your D10 EMS will work with your SV (assuming same engine) but you will need to have the SV EMS module to send that data to the SV.
In order to have a working SV EFIS you will need the ADHARS (Attitude and Heading Reference System). It's similar to your D10 EFIS on steroids. It's a good idea to have the backup battery.
